As far back as 1988, a SECUMAR Bolero® lifejacket model won the safety prize at the Hanseboot International Boat Show – and now Bernhardt Apparatebau is presenting a much improved version of this lifejacket classic. SECUMAR designers have refined the interface between harness system and buoyancy chamber in the chest area of the lifejacket making it particularly comfortable for women to wear.
The proven design of the basic vest remains unchanged. The basis for the harness and the lifejacket is a short bolero jacket, into which the harness straps are integrated. The lifejacket stands out because of its cut, which is short making it seem even smaller than it really is. The new special yoke on the front of the lifejacket means that it fits snugly over the chest. At the same time, the D-ring on the harness does not rest too low down. It is also notable that the SECUMAR Bolero® does not chafe on the neck like many other lifejackets because of the even distribution of its reduced weight on the wearer’s shoulders.
The SECUMAR Bolero® comes in various versions. It is available in 150 N and 275 N versions and the protective cover also comes in various colour combinations – blue/red, red/blue and sand/blue.
The SECUMAR Bolero® is fitted with the Window check system for the gas cartridge, as well as the click buckle designed along the lines of a car seat belt fastening. It has a mesh back for an improved fit, a soft neck fleece, free manual override device, crutch straps as standard, and comes in a neat bag for stowage.
In addition, an air permeable sprayhood, a lifejacket light, and a manual override can be fitted. All this makes it suitable for yachting, cruising, and motor-boating, as well as blue-water sailing.
